What you'll do:
As an Account Documentation Analyst, you will be instrumental in supporting the private wealth management division's mission to deliver exceptional client experiences through rigorous documentation review and efficient account administration.
- Review comprehensive documentation packs from Sales teams, including Client Identification Program documents, Account Application or Update forms, Investment Profile Questionnaires, Tax documents, and other required materials.
- Communicate promptly and clearly with Sales regarding any missing documentation, inconsistencies in information, or incorrect data identified during the review process.
- Ensure precise data entry into onboarding or account maintenance workflow tools based on submitted documentation and Know Your Customer (KYC) information.
- Maintain accurate records of account documentation and relevant approval files within internal databases while monitoring the timely receipt of outstanding documents.
- Liaise effectively with Sales teams and other stakeholders to resolve issues related to missing or inconsistent documentation for both new account onboarding and existing account updates.
- Handle various administrative tasks such as document scanning, data entry checks, first-level case reviews, policy or procedure updates, SharePoint updates, and management reporting as needed.
- Support compliance efforts by adhering strictly to internal policies and regulatory requirements throughout all stages of account management.
- Adapt quickly to ad-hoc requests or urgent administrative needs that arise within the team's remit.
- Contribute positively to projects aimed at improving processes within the Account Management Team by providing feedback and participating in discussions.
- Demonstrate sensitivity when handling confidential client information and ensure all actions align with best practices in data protection.
What you bring:
The ideal candidate for the Account Documentation Analyst position brings substantial experience from banking or financial services settings where precision in handling sensitive client information is paramount.
- Demonstrated knowledge of Client Identification Program (CIP) requirements and KYC documentation processes within financial services environments.
- Familiarity with complex account structures including individual accounts, personal holding companies (PHCs), trusts, funds, subsidiaries of listed companies, and operating vehicles.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ills that enable clear interaction with colleagues across departments as well as external stakeholders.
- Proven ability to adapt efficiently when managing multiple tasks or responding to ad-hoc administrative requests under tight deadlines.
- Willingness to learn new procedures quickly while maintaining high standards of accuracy in all aspects of documentation handling.
- Experience with SOW corroboration (Source of Wealth) and TNW substantiation (Total Net Worth) is considered advantageous but not mandatory.
- Proficiency in Chinese language (speaking and reading) is highly desirable due to the nature of client interactions involved in this role.
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ent education/experience is required; additional qualifications in finance or compliance are beneficial.
- At least five years' professional experience within banking or financial services sectors is expected for success in this position.
- Prior exposure to private banking environments or direct involvement in onboarding/KYC/SOW review processes would be an asset.
